How long is the wait for a sciatica at Hereford County Hospital?

The NHS does not publish waiting times for individual hospitals. This figure is for Wye Valley NHS Trust, which runs Hereford County Hospital, and it is the wait that applies to you here.

52weeks

Updated June 2026 · (Referral to Treatment — the NHS wait-time framework)

This is how long 8 in 10 patients wait for the whole Trauma & Orthopaedics specialty at this trust, from GP referral to the start of treatment — the NHS does not publish a wait for sciatica on its own.

Before treatment: the scan wait too

3weekstypical MRI wait · June 2026

An MRI scan is a separate NHS queue from the treatment wait above, and it comes first. At Wye Valley NHS Trust the typical MRI wait is 3 weeks, with 14% waiting over six weeks (June 2026).
